net: Allow changing number of RX queues after device allocation

For RPS, we create a kobject for each RX queue based on the number of
queues passed to alloc_netdev_mq().  However, drivers generally do not
determine the numbers of hardware queues to use until much later, so
this usually represents the maximum number the driver may use and not
the actual number in use.

For TX queues, drivers can update the actual number using
netif_set_real_num_tx_queues().  Add a corresponding function for RX
queues, netif_set_real_num_rx_queues().

+#ifdef CONFIG_RPS
+/**
+ *	netif_set_real_num_rx_queues - set actual number of RX queues used
+ *	@dev: Network device
+ *	@rxq: Actual number of RX queues
+ *
+ *	This must be called either with the rtnl_lock held or before
+ *	registration of the net device.  Returns 0 on success, or a
+ *	negative error code.  If called before registration, it also
+ *	sets the maximum number of queues, and always succeeds.
+ */
+int netif_set_real_num_rx_queues(struct net_device *dev, unsigned int rxq)
+{
+	int rc;
+
+	if (dev->reg_state == NETREG_REGISTERED) {
+		ASSERT_RTNL();
+
+		if (rxq > dev->num_rx_queues)
+			return -EINVAL;
+
+		rc = net_rx_queue_update_kobjects(dev, dev->real_num_rx_queues,
+						  rxq);
+		if (rc)
+			return rc;
+	} else {
+		dev->num_rx_queues = rxq;
+	}
+
+	dev->real_num_rx_queues = rxq;
+	return 0;
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(netif_set_real_num_rx_queues);
+#endif
